Different stages of De-Aging DeNiro by BlueVoid in StableDiffusion

[–]BlueVoid[S] 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I'm new to StableDiffusion and this was my first attempt at a video. I used batch Img2Img with a mask and ControlNet, then passed that through EbSynth, then upscaled that with ControlNet Tiling and another pass through EbSynth.

The masking on it is very rough since I don't have any software for it. I just used a python script for face tracking and had it draw an ellipse.
